The Meanwell NSP 75W, 100W, 150W, 200W and 320W units are "industrial" caged models designed to replace the RSP-75, RSP-100, RSP-150, RSP-200 and RSP-320 models. The NSP models are smaller and lighter, are more efficient, operate over a wider temperature range and have better isolation being approved for medical applications, SEMI47 and DEKRA. All NSP models have active PFC (Power Factor Correction)+ and reduced operating and inrush current as a result. All have remote ON/OFF control (ideal for switching loads on and off such as with temperature control of a heater or fan) and the 150W model and above have a DC OK signal and Remote Voltage Sensing. All 12V to 60V output models have 200% peak* current for 5 seconds and will recover automatically from overload provided that Vo > 30% (ideal for driving motors, lamps, DC-DC converters etc). They also have OTP Over Temperature Protection and Over Voltage Protection (OVP) and a 5 year Australian warranty. *200% when operated at 240VAC, 150% when AC input is less then 180VAC (see data sheet).
75W Series
The NSP-75-5 = 5V@15A, NSP-75-12 = 12V@6.3A, NSP-75-15 = 15V@5A, NSP-75-24 = 24V@3.2A, NSP-75-27 = 27V@2.8A, NSP-75-36 = 36V@2.1A, NSP-75-48 = 48V@1.6A and NSP-75-60 = 60V@1.3A
The NSP-75 weighs 0.3kg and size 99x97x30mm.
100W Series
The NSP-100-5 = 5V@20A, NSP-100-7.5 = 7.5V@13.4A, NSP-100-12 = 12V@8.5A, NSP-100-15 = 15V@6.7A, NSP-100-24 = 24V@4.2A, NSP-100-27 = 27V@3.7A, NSP-100-36 = 36V@2.8A, NSP-100-48 = 48V@2.1A and NSP-100-60 = 60V@1.7A
The NSP-100 weighs 0.3kg and size 99x97x30mm.
150W Series
The NSP-150-5 = 5V@30A, NSP-150-7.5 = 7.5V@20A, NSP-150-12 = 12V@12.5A, NSP-150-15 = 15V@10A, NSP-150-24 = 24V@6.3A, NSP-150-27 = 27V@5.6A, NSP-150-36 = 36V@4.2A, NSP-150-48 = 48V@3.15A and NSP-150-60 = 60V@2.55A
The NSP-150 weighs 0.4kg and size 129x97x30mm.
200W Series
The NSP-200-5 = 5V@40A, NSP-200-7.5 = 7.5V@26.8A, NSP-200-12 = 12V@16.7A, NSP-200-15 = 15V@13.4A, NSP-200-24 = 24V@8.4A, NSP-200-27 = 27V@7.4A, NSP-200-36 = 36V@5.56A, NSP-200-48 = 48V@4.2A and NSP-200-60 = 60V@3.36A
The NSP-200 weighs 0.5kg and size 159x97x30mm.
320W Series
The NSP-320-5 = 5V@60A (5V x 60A = 300W), NSP-200-7.5 = 7.5V@40A (7.5V x 40A = 300W), NSP-320-12 = 12V@26.7A, NSP-320-15 = 15V@21.4A, NSP-320-24 = 24V@13.4A, NSP-320-27 = 27V@11.9A, NSP-320-36 = 36V@8.9A, NSP-320-48 = 48V@6.7A and NSP-320-60 = 60V@5.4A
The NSP-320 weighs 0.67kg and size 179x99x30mm.
Please note that these Meanwell power supplies provide a "regulated" DC output and those less than 12V may not supply the wattage as suggested in the model no. (e.g. the NSP-320-5 provides 5V at 60 Amps hence it supplies 5 x 60 = 300 Watts max. not 320 Watts). They also operate from 95VAC to 280VAC input and provide an output voltage adjustable such that any voltage between 7V and 72V is possible. Many voltages such as 9V, 13.8V, 18V, 27.6V, 32V, 40V, 45V, 55.2V, 69V can be obtained for battery charging or other applications. MEAN WELL Enterprises Co., is a Taiwan based company started in 1982 with strong ties worldwide (some well-known companies re-badge their products) and they provide excellent support and backup. Meanwell is a TQM (Total Quality Management) company and is ISO9001 certified. In 2017, the 2-year return rate was 1 in 6600. This unit has exposed 240VAC terminals and must be installed inside a suitable enclosure according to local electrical authority regulations. +NOTE, any power supply above 150W that does not have POWER FACTOR CORRECTION most-likely does not meet C-TICK or EMI requirements for use, on 240VAC mains in Australia! You can generally tell if a high-wattage (> 150W) power supply does NOT have "active" PFC because it will have a switch to select 115VAC or 230VAC. The advantage of "active" PFC is that not only is the AC mains current reduced (and of course "in phase" with voltage... something that power companies prefer), but the electrical interference (EMI) is reduced (less harmonics) BUT also it stablises the input allowing the AC voltage to vary greatly WITHOUT having to use a SWITCH which activates voltage doubling when the AC input is less than 180VAC.
